It's funny. All answers here, are (in my experience), for the average beginner user too complex.
I have been thinking about creating a 'SimpleGeometryBuilder'-plugin or so. But... it is getting more complex very soon: One because they do often not have a layer yet, so a proper layer should be created (like in the WKT-plugin)... OR added to an existing layer (of the same type). AND we do need the crs (but could for example check if coord values are <180 and then decide on EPSG:4326 automagically.. But, in our region, one pastes numbers from with comma as decimal separator, so it should be possible to choose that.. And I would also want it to be possible to give 4 coordinate pairs and then decide if these are 4 individual points, or should form a line or a polygon... I would be still interested in creating such plugin, if enough interest. But maybe I overlooked and something like this is already there, OR those users should just use to 1) create a layer+crs first 2) use the edit/vertex tools of QGIS...
